Choosing the Right Tarot Deck for Travel

Selecting a tarot deck that resonates with one’s travel intentions is an essential step in integrating tarot into the travel experience. There are countless tarot decks available, each with its own unique artwork, symbolism, and energy. For travelers, it may be beneficial to choose a deck that embodies themes of exploration, adventure, or cultural diversity.

For instance, decks inspired by different cultures or mythologies can enhance the travel experience by providing a deeper connection to the places being visited. Practical considerations also play a role in choosing a travel-friendly tarot deck. A smaller-sized deck is often more convenient for packing and carrying during trips.

Additionally, some travelers may prefer decks made from durable materials that can withstand wear and tear while on the road. The Wild Unknown Tarot or the Everyday Tarot are examples of decks that are both visually appealing and compact enough for travel. Ultimately, the right deck should resonate personally with the traveler, evoking feelings of inspiration and curiosity that align with their journey.

Tarot Spreads for Travel Readings

Utilizing specific tarot spreads designed for travel readings can enhance the depth of insights gained from each session. One popular spread is the “Travel Journey Spread,” which typically consists of five cards representing different aspects of the journey: the starting point, challenges ahead, opportunities for growth, potential outcomes, and advice from the universe. This spread allows travelers to gain a comprehensive view of their journey’s dynamics and encourages them to reflect on how each aspect influences their overall experience.

Another effective spread is the “Destination Spread,” which focuses on a specific location or experience. In this spread, travelers draw cards that explore what they might encounter at their destination—cultural insights, personal challenges, or unexpected joys. This approach not only prepares travelers for what lies ahead but also encourages them to remain open to new experiences that may arise during their travels.

By engaging with these tailored spreads, individuals can deepen their understanding of their journeys and cultivate a sense of mindfulness throughout their adventures.

Tips for Incorporating Tarot into Your Travel Routine

Integrating tarot into a travel routine can be both enriching and transformative. One effective way to do this is by establishing a daily ritual that includes drawing cards each morning or evening during your travels.

This practice allows travelers to set intentions for the day ahead or reflect on their experiences at day’s end.

For instance, drawing a card in the morning could provide guidance on how to approach interactions with locals or navigate cultural differences throughout the day. Another tip is to keep a travel journal alongside your tarot practice. Documenting insights gained from readings alongside personal reflections creates a rich tapestry of experiences that can be revisited long after the journey has ended.

This journal could include sketches of drawn cards, notes on how they resonated with daily experiences, or even photographs from significant moments during the trip. By combining tarot with journaling, travelers can cultivate a deeper understanding of themselves and their journeys while creating lasting memories.
